On your first day in Egypt, a tour manager from Cairo Top Tours will meet you at Luxor Airport, the railway station, or your hotel and take you to the MS Nile Radamis Nile cruise in an air-conditioned vehicle. After having a tasty buffet lunch on the cruise, you will embark on a tour of the East Bank of Luxor with your guide. Your first stop will be the grand Karnak Temple, which was devoted to the sun god Amun-Ra, goddess Mut, and their son, the moon god Khonso. Next, you will visit the marvelous Luxor Temple, which is one of the most well-known temples constructed during the New Kingdom era. In the evening, you will enjoy a delicious dinner on the cruise ship while watching an entertaining folkloric show. You will spend the night in Luxor City.

After enjoying an open buffet breakfast on board the MS Nile Radamis Egypt Nile River Cruise, continue your Luxor day tours with your Egyptologist guide and private driver who will take you to the West Bank of Luxor. Explore the Valley of the Kings and learn about the royal tombs in ancient Egypt. Visit the Temple of Hatshepsut, also known as the Temple of El Dier El Bahari, and see the colossal statues of King Amenhotep III, known as the Colossi of Memnon. After the tour, return to the Nile Cruise for a tasty lunch onboard and then sail to Edfu. Enjoy dinner on board and spend the night in Edfu.

Your Egypt luxury package continues this morning with a delicious breakfast served on board the Nile River cruise ship made from fresh ingredients. After breakfast, a representative from Cairo Top Tours will accompany you to visit the Edfu Temple of God Horus, the protector of kingship, depicted as a falcon-headed man with two great wings. The boat will then sail towards Aswan, stopping at the town of Kom Ombo, known from ancient times, where you will explore the Ptolemaic Temple of Kom Ombo with your accredited Egyptologist guide, built to honor the crocodile Gods of ancient Egypt, Sobek, and Haroeris.
After lunch on board, the boat will continue sailing down the Nile to Aswan. Enjoy dinner on board in the evening while watching the Nubian show.

Start your day with a delicious open-buffet breakfast on board the boat before heading out for Aswan Day tours. Your first stop will be the Great High Dam, built to control the Nile water during the agricultural year, saving water, and generating electric power. Next, visit the Unfinished Obelisk in the granite quarries, which was probably made for Queen Hatshepsut but was never finished. Then, explore the Philae Temple, one of the most interesting temples built in the same style of architecture as in the Greco-Roman era, dedicated to the worship of Goddess Isis.
Enjoy a savory lunch while sailing with your MS Nile Radamis Nile Cruise in the evening. Your dinner will also be served aboard the boat, and you will spend the night in the amazing city of Aswan.
